The Evolution of Shipping Containers
Shipping containers have come a long way given that their creation in the 1950s. Originally developed to facilitate maritime transport, these containers have actually expanded their usage to intermodal transport, which includes rail and truck logistics. The versatility and performance of shipping containers have made them the foundation of global trade.
Over the past few years, manufacturers have actually presented new innovations to boost the efficiency of shipping containers. These developments intend to address obstacles such as storage effectiveness, sustainability, and security.
Key Innovations in New Shipping Containers
Aerated and Temperature-Controlled Containers
- These containers are designed for carrying perishable items. Equipped with temperature tracking systems, they ensure that delicate products like fruits, veggies, and pharmaceuticals preserve their perfect conditions throughout the shipping process.
Modified and Expandable Containers
- Some shipping containers can be modified or broadened to accommodate different cargo sizes. This versatility enables better usage of space, reducing empty journeys and maximizing cargo capability.
Smart Containers
- With the arrival of IoT (Internet of Things) technology, clever shipping containers are gaining popularity. These containers come equipped with sensors that keep an eye on location, temperature level, and humidity. They allow logistics business to track shipments more exactly and maintain optimal conditions for delicate cargo.
Eco-Friendly Containers
- Sustainability is significantly essential in the shipping market. New shipping containers are being manufactured from recyclable products or developed for energy performance. Some business are try out solar panels or energy-storage systems to reduce the carbon footprint of shipping operations.
High-Cube and Double-Stack Containers
- High-cube containers use an additional foot in height, permitting more efficient stacking and the transport of bigger items. Double-stack containers take full advantage of space utilization on trains and vessels, lowering transportation expenses.
Kinds Of New Shipping Containers
| Container Type | Description | Common Uses |
|---|---|---|
| Requirement Container | The most common type, used for basic cargo. Dimensions typically 20 ft and 40 feet long. | Non-perishable goods |
| Reefer Container | Refrigerated container created to transport disposable goods at regulated temperature levels. | Foodstuff, pharmaceuticals |
| Flat Rack Container | Structure without sides or a roofing, permitting simple loading of large or heavy cargo. | Equipment, cars |
| Open Top Container | Functions a detachable tarp top, permitting for tall cargo that can not fit through standard doors. | Bulk products, construction products |
| Tank Container | Specifically developed for transporting liquids, consisting of hazardous materials. | Chemicals, food-grade liquids |
| Modified Container | Custom-made for specific cargo needs, such as office areas, housing, or workshops. | Short-term structures |

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What are shipping containers primarily made of?
A1: Most shipping containers are made from steel for toughness and strength. Some new designs may integrate recyclable products for environment-friendly options.
Q2: How do temperature-controlled containers preserve their conditions?
A2: Temperature-controlled containers utilize refrigeration systems that actively monitor and change the internal temperature, ensuring stability for disposable products.
Q3: How are wise shipping containers tracked?
A3: Smart containers are equipped with IoT sensors that transfer information to a main system, allowing fleet managers to keep track of places, conditions, and more in real-time.
Q4: Can shipping containers be used for functions aside from transport?
A4: Yes, shipping containers can be modified for various uses, including storage, housing, pop-up stores, and even offices.
Q5: What are the advantages of utilizing environment-friendly shipping containers?
A5: Eco-friendly containers decrease the environmental effect of shipping operations, aid businesses meet sustainability objectives, and attract ecologically mindful consumers.
